REST API

processorInformation. transactionIntegrityCode

Transaction integrity classification provided by Mastercard.
This field is returned only for
Visa Platform Connect
.
This value indicates Mastercard’s evaluation of the transaction’s safety and security.
Possible values for card-present transactions:
  • A1
    : EMV or token in a secure, trusted environment.
  • B1
    : EMV or chip equivalent.
  • C1
    : Magnetic stripe.
  • E1
    : Key entered.
  • U0
    : Unclassified.
Possible values for card-not-present transactions:
  • A2
    : Digital transactions.
  • B2
    : Authenticated checkout.
  • C2
    : Transaction validation.
  • D2
    : Enhanced data.
  • E2
    : Generic messaging.
  • U0
    : Unclassified.
For information about these values, contact Mastercard or your acquirer.
The value for this field corresponds to the following data in the TC 33 capture file:
  • Record: CP01 TCR6
  • Position: 136-137
  • Field: Mastercard Transaction Integrity Classification

Specifications

  • Data Type:
    String
  • Data Length:
    2

Mapping Information

  • REST API Field:
    processorInformation.transactionIntegrityCode
  • SCMP API Field:
    auth_transaction_integrity
  • Simple Order API Field:
    ccAuthReply_transactionIntegrity